One of the most efficient scorers in Ivy League history, Craig Robinson led the League in field goal percentage as a junior in 1981-82 (57.7) and as a senior in 1982-83 (64.2) en route to back-to-back Ivy League Player of the Year nods. Craig Malcolm Robinson (born April 21, 1962) is an American college basketball coach and the current head men's basketball coach at Oregon State University.He was previously the head coach at Brown University.He was a star forward as a player at Princeton University in the early 1980s and a bond trader during the 1990s..
